t. Andrew’s Church, a faith community that is part of the greater Church of Trenton, was formed by God to embody an active faith based on the guidance of the Holy Spirit. We are a welcoming community challenged by the proclamation of the Good News of Jesus to all; evangelical in our acceptance of all people; joyful in our celebration of the liturgy; dedicated to our education of the faith to all people; conscience of human needs, dignity and justice; and we bring these gifts to share our faith and resources as God’s family.
